Museums and Art Galleries

Begin your cultural journey at the Naples National Archaeological Museum, home to an extensive collection of artifacts from Pompeii and Herculaneum. Immerse yourself in the city's artistic legacy by exploring the contemporary pieces at the Museum of Contemporary Art Donnaregina (MADRE).

Theaters and Performances

For a taste of Naples' theatrical vibrancy, catch a performance at the historic Teatro di San Carlo, one of the oldest continuously active opera houses in the world. Alternatively, indulge in avant-garde productions at the Mercadante Theatre.

Landmarks and Ancient Sites

Step back in time at the imposing Castel dell'Ovo, a seaside fortress with a history dating back to Roman times. Explore the narrow streets of the historic center,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and witness the awe-inspiring frescoes at the Chiesa del Gesù Nuovo.

Historical Architecture

Naples boasts a blend of architectural styles, and a stroll through the Spaccanapoli district reveals a captivating mix of Gothic, Renaissance, and Baroque structures. Marvel at the grandiosity of the Royal Palace of Naples, an architectural masterpiece that reflects the city's royal past.

Panoramic Views

For breathtaking panoramic views of Naples and the Bay of Naples, head to Castel Sant'Elmo. Perched atop the Vomero hill, this medieval fortress not only provides a glimpse into history but also offers an unparalleled vantage point.

Parks and Natural Attractions

Escape the urban hustle at the serene Villa Comunale, a picturesque park by the sea. A leisurely stroll through the vibrant gardens and fountains makes for a perfect afternoon. Additionally, explore the natural beauty of the Phlegraean Fields, a volcanic area with hot springs and stunning landscapes.

Street Art

Discover Naples' street art scene in the Rione Sanità district. Murals by local and international artists adorn the walls, turning the neighborhood into an open-air gallery that reflects the city's contemporary spirit.

Regional Specialties

Indulge your taste buds in the local culinary scene by trying regional specialties such as sfogliatella pastries and mozzarella di bufala. Visit the vibrant Mercato di Porta Nolana to sample a variety of local delights.

Sacred Traditions

Delve into the spiritual side of Naples by witnessing the annual Feast of San Gennaro. This religious celebration honors the city's patron saint with processions, religious rites, and lively street festivals.

Best Times to Visit

To avoid the peak tourist season and enjoy milder weather, plan your visit to Naples in the spring (April to June) or fall (September to October). This allows for a more comfortable exploration of outdoor attractions and cultural sites.
